AN organisation which brings together a range of services to give the town a united voice has been inspected by a government watchdog body.

The Audit Commission reviewed how the Hartlepool Partnership performs.

The commission's report identified key strengths in terms of being inclusive and meeting challenges but it acknowledged there was room for improvement in the way performance information was reported.

The report said the Hartlepool Partnership had a significant role to play in shaping the future of the town and implementing the Government's Neighbourhood Renewal initiative, which is designed to uplift deprived areas of the town.
